Abstract
Blepharitis is an inflammation of the eyelid margins which sometimes leads to secondary changes in the conjunctiva and cornea. Symptoms of blepharitis tend to be longstanding, thus, blepharitis is more of a chronic condition than being acute and both eyes are usually affected, however, the symptoms can easily be eased.Once symptoms have eased, daily'eyelidhygiene' canusuallykeepthe symptoms toa minimum. Vision is rarely affected. This case report reviewed themanagement of blepharitis in a 25-year old girl the clinical findings andtreatment optionswerealsodiscussed.
